Top of the page

3D printing

1
Price €37.5
5 in stock
2
Price €37.5
3 in stock
3
Price €37.5
Available on backorder
4
Price €30
Suggested Retail Price €37.5
Retail discount 20%
3 in stock
5
Price €67.96
Suggested Retail Price €84.95
Retail discount 20%
1 in stock
6
Price €44.95
Available on backorder
7
Price €44.95
Available on backorder
8
Price €25.37
Suggested Retail Price €36.25
Retail discount 30.01%
Available on backorder
9
Price €54.5
10 in stock
10
Price €19.75
40 in stock
11
Price €54.5
10 in stock
12
Price €19.75
Available on backorder
103 product(s) found

3D printing

1
Price €37.5
5 in stock
2
Price €37.5
3 in stock
3
Price €37.5
Available on backorder
4
Price €30
Suggested Retail Price €37.5
Retail discount 20%
3 in stock
5
Price €67.96
Suggested Retail Price €84.95
Retail discount 20%
1 in stock
6
Price €44.95
Available on backorder
7
Price €44.95
Available on backorder
8
Price €25.37
Suggested Retail Price €36.25
Retail discount 30.01%
Available on backorder
9
Price €54.5
10 in stock
10
Price €19.75
40 in stock
11
Price €54.5
10 in stock
12
Price €19.75
Available on backorder